Web18 mei 2024 · Melting point of butter: 33 degrees Celsius Melting point of butter: 38 degrees Celsius 2 = 35.5 °C What is the burning temperature of butter? Butter is used for sautéing and frying, although its milk solids brown and burn above 150 °C (250 °F)—a rather low temperature for most applications. Web14 feb. 2024 · cocoa butter softens and lubricates the skin. This yellowish vegetable fat is solid at room temperature but liquefies at temperatures between 90o–100oF (32.2o–37.8oC). Thus, it is frequently used in lip balms and massage creams because of its favorable melting point (i.e., close to body temperature).
